Buyers Laboratory (BLI) have just announced their 2012 Winter Pick Selection and the award goes to Sharp MX-2310U the top performer in the entry level photocopier range. The remarkable A3 colour multifunction printer with 23 prints per minute outclassed every competitor in the segment. BLI is the independent tester in the imaging industry, performing regular tests popular business printing products.

BLI are in the habit of testing the full range of multifunctional printers while
charting out the best responses and it was here that the superior printing
quality of the Sharp photocopier became
apparent. The test revealed flawless print quality even on large volumes, while
running at the advertised speed of 23 prints per minute, on large format A3 in
both colour plus black and white. BLI assistant managing editor Lynn Nannarielo
acknowledged that "colours were bright and saturated, yet fresh tones
remained natural-looking. Output was also smooth and sharp, and colour halftone
range exhibited distinct separation between all levels."
Special relevance even among Sharp photocopiers is
MX2310 resilience while running extensive print jobs. BLI revealed that the
standard test involved printing 100,000 impressions in a test sample that
represents a monthly workload for a rather busy office photocopier. There were
precisely no misfeeds or print flaws. These numbers are well within recommended
usage and it is good to see that Sharp copiers do not need technical assistance
and servicing on stress tests. Sharp MX 2310 presents the Open System
Architecture enabling hassle free connections to third party applications
like managed print services and document management
solutions. For the outstanding price level, this office VIP has
distinguished itself among photocopier candidates. BLI recommends it as a prime
candidate for any company that requires a monthly print volume in excess of 13,500
impressions.
